Imposing Greece defeat Ireland in Nations League match

·

Greece claimed its second victory in the UEFA Nations League on Tuesday, defeating Ireland 2-0. Both goals came in the second half.

The Greek team was more composed against Ireland compared to their match with Finland three nights earlier.

Greece’s goalkeeper Odysseas Vlachodimos was hardly busy throughout the game, except for a 41st-minute goal that was correctly disallowed as offside.

In the first half, Greece’s Tasos Bakasetas and Konstantinos Koulierakis came close to scoring with no luck.

Four minutes into the second half, Fotis Ioannidis placed a well-taken shot to the top corner of the Ireland goal for 1-0.

Three minutes from the end, Christos Tzolis had a spectacular solo effort from a Bakasetas pass end up in the back of the net, to seal victory for the Greek national team.

Greece’s next game is on October 10 against England at Wembley.
